West Virginia is home to a low job market for Construction Laborers. The state's key industries — Energy, Healthcare, Manufacturing — generate significant demand for skilled professionals. At $32,807 per year, West Virginia's Construction Laborer salaries are 22.0% lower than the national average.
The cost of living in West Virginia (index: 0.78) makes salaries stretch further than in higher-cost states. Entry-level professionals in West Virginia can expect to earn $24,024–$30,354, while experienced Construction Laborers can command $44,597–$49,766.
Looking ahead, the Construction Laborer profession in West Virginia is projected to grow at 2.8% annually. Major employers are actively hiring, and the state's investment in Energy continues to drive new opportunities for qualified candidates.
